Grilled Mackerel
고등어구이
A grilled mackerel dish seasoned with soy sauce. The outside is crispy and the inside is moist, making it great to eat with rice. It is characterized by its savory and light taste.
Pork Back Rib Stew
돼지등갈비찜
A braised dish made by simmering tenderly boiled pork back ribs in a sweet and spicy sauce. The meat is tender and easy to eat, and it's popular as a side dish for rice.
Ttukbaegi Bulgogi
뚝배기불고기
A sweet and savory bulgogi served hot in a ttukbaegi (earthenware pot). It's great for mixing with rice in the broth, and it's a flavor that everyone, young and old, loves.
Spicy Stir-fried Baby Octopus
쭈꾸미볶음
A dish made by stir-frying chewy baby octopus with spicy seasoning. It is characterized by its spicy yet savory flavor and is good for relieving stress.
Stone Pot Bibimbap
돌솥비빔밥
A traditional Korean dish where various vegetables, meat, and egg are mixed and eaten in a hot stone pot. It's fun to scrape off the scorched rice at the bottom.
Grilled Dried Pollack
황태구이
A dish made by grilling well-dried dried pollack with seasoning. It is characterized by its light yet chewy texture, making it a good side dish for rice or a snack with drinks.
Spicy Stir-fried Pork
제육볶음
A spicy dish made by stir-frying pork seasoned with gochujang (red chili paste). It boasts a fantastic combination when eaten with rice.
Saury Stew
꽁치찌개
A stew made with kimchi and saury, boiled spicy. The refreshing and spicy broth is excellent. Eat it hot with rice.
Kimchi Jjigae (Kimchi Stew)
김치찌개
A representative Korean stew, made by boiling well-fermented kimchi and pork in a spicy and refreshing broth. It tastes even better with rice.
Doenjang Jjigae (Soybean Paste Stew)
된장찌개
A traditional Korean stew made with savory doenjang (soybean paste), tofu, and vegetables. It is characterized by its deep and rich flavor and pairs well with rice.
Steamed Egg
계란찜
A gently steamed egg dish. It is characterized by its salty and savory taste and is good to eat with spicy food.
Soft Tofu
순두부
A stew made with soft tofu. Mixing rice with the spicy and refreshing broth will fill you up.
Perilla Soft Tofu Stew
들깨순두부
A soft tofu stew characterized by its savory and thick taste with perilla powder. Recommended for those who prefer a softer and lighter taste than regular soft tofu stew.
Clear Soft Tofu
맑은순두부
A soft tofu stew made with a clear broth without red chili powder. You can enjoy a non-irritating and refreshing taste.
Curry Soft Tofu Stew
카레순두부
A unique soft tofu stew that combines the fragrant flavor of curry with the softness of soft tofu. The familiar curry taste is enhanced by the texture of soft tofu, offering a special experience.
Cheonggukjang Soft Tofu Stew
청국장순두부
A soft tofu stew based on savory cheonggukjang (fermented soybean paste). The deep and rich flavor of fermented beans harmonizes with the softness of the soft tofu.
Cheese
치즈
Cheese that can be added to various stews or stir-fried dishes for a richer and more savory flavor. It enhances the taste of the food.
Spicy Braised Chicken
닭볶음탕
A braised dish made with chicken, potatoes, and vegetables in a spicy sauce. It is characterized by its spicy and rich flavor, and is good with rice or as a snack with drinks.
Pork Back Rib Stew (Large)
돼지등갈비찜 (대)
A sweet and spicy pork back rib stew, generously portioned and great for sharing among several people. The tender meat and deep sauce flavor are well-balanced.
Saury Stew (Large)
꽁치찌개 (대)
A hearty and spicy saury stew, great for sharing among several people. The refreshing and spicy broth is excellent. Enjoy it hot with rice.
Rolled Omelet
계란말이
A soft and thickly rolled omelet. It has a savory and light taste, and is good to eat with spicy food or is a favorite for children.
